1912 Packard 30 Model UE touring car, parked on street with two couples

8x10 black and white print copied from a glass negative of a 1912 Packard 30 Model UE parked on street with passengers, two couples, two spare tires stored on side, right side view, top lowered. Inscribed on photo back; 4-cylinder, 40-horsepower, 123.5-inch wheelbase, 7-person touring car, with standard top & Packard storm-tilt windshield, initials P.R.S. on tonneau door monogram panel.

1913 Packard 48 limousine, interior detail

8x10 black and white print copied from a glass negative of a 1913 Packard 48. Inscribed on photo back; 6-cylinder, 48-horsepower ALAM rating, 82-horsepower at 1720 r.p.m., 133-inch wheelbase, 7-person limousine, interior detail, Pullman chair-type auxiliary seat.

1915 Packard 3-38 two-toned standard touring car, left side, top raised

7.5x9.5 black and white Packard Co. file photograph of a 1915 Packard 3-38 two-toned, top raised, left side. Inscribed on photo back; 6-cylinder, 38-horsepower, 140-inch wheelbase, 7-person standard touring car.
